The Sourcing Analyst will be part of a Strategic Sourcing team whose team’s mission is to bring to Disney the best the marketplace has to offer. This mission is accomplished by a combination of segment, category, and geographic teams working collaboratively with stakeholders across every business segment around the world, utilizing a systematic approach to managing the acquisition of goods and services aimed at matching stakeholders’ needs with marketplace capabilities while achieving the lowest total cost of ownership. Strategic Sourcing’s operational goals include enabling achievement of The Walt Disney Company’s strategic priorities through effective sourcing and procurement execution, supporting margin improvement by helping deliver bottom-line financial benefits, and delivering additional business value through initiatives focused on operational excellence.
The Sourcing Analyst will support the execution of Strategic Sourcing projects & strategies.
RESPONSIBILITIES:
- This role will facilitate the competitive bidding of F&B Novelties, collaborating with the stakeholder on requirements, and managing contracts associated with this category.
- Lead and/or support complex sourcing initiatives by assisting in feasibility assessments, providing analysis of current and projected spend, market analysis and trends, best practices identification, RFP preparation, market baskets, bid analysis and supplier performance monitoring.
- Lead and/or support process re-design initiatives with comprehensive analysis of current and proposed changes including cost/benefits analysis, identifying risks and formulating business case.
- Support Strategic Sourcing organization by developing, aggregating, analyzing and reporting spend, performance measurements and metrics and other attributes utilizing a variety of tools involving procurement activities.
- Create and maintain clear and compelling F&B data visualization dashboards using tools within Crunctime, Power BI or Tableau.
- Develop and maintain SQL queries and scripts for F&B data analysis and reporting, while monitoring data quality and optimizing data processes and workflows.
- Maintain and/or develop F&B process workflows in Power Automate.
- Support reporting requirements and other category metrics.
- Create and maintain Outline Agreements and its contents in SAP related to Pricing, Lead time and Source of Supply in coordination with Sourcing Specialists.
- Assist in budget monitoring and value-added calculations.
